At the games this weekend, there will be a silent auction which will benefit the Falcon Hockey program. Items will be on display in the lobby during both games. The following items will be up for auction:
Autographed Alexander Ovechkin Jersey
Team Autographed Kevin Bieksa Jersey
Team Autographed New York Islanders Stick
Darryl Sittler Autographed Hockey Stick
More items may be added. Keep checking back to this thread. I'll post if I hear that more items will be put up for auction!!
